About the Great wall Steed
The Great wall Steed has been tested 1,274 times in 2024 MOT data across 5 model years (2013 to 2017), with an average pass rate of 71%. That's 11 points below the national average of 82%, so check the year-by-year data carefully before buying. Available as diesel.
Best and Worst Years
The 2016 model is the most reliable with a 77% pass rate from 301 tests. The 2014 model has the lowest at 68%. The 9 point spread between years means reliability varies somewhat, but no year is dramatically different.
Reliability Trend
Newer GREAT WALL STEEDs show better MOT pass rates than older ones, with an average improvement of 6 percentage points.
Mileage Across Years
The oldest model in our data (2013) averages 82,023 miles, while the newest (2017) averages 55,469 miles.
